Several decades before the occurrence of the Second World War, nearly fifty percent of the American population had their own houses; however, after the war was over, most young families have decided to purchase their own houses, mostly aiming to make a brand new start by living in their newly bought houses. It was a time when home buyers were highly motivated to buy their own homes and have actually flooded the market which has created the most number of home buying deals.
However, over the decades, some factors have continuously altered the course of the home buying market. One of these factors includes the rise of interest rates as the years have progressed after the war. But still, some buyers were decided to purchase their so-called dream houses. These buyers were surprisingly eager to purchase homes even at such high prices just to satisfy the urge of finally settling down in houses where they dream to stay for good.
Nowadays, home buyers do not find it easy to stretch their budget and most of them tend to be more cautious. They allot some time to think if they actually have the financial capacity to buy a dream house in Nokomis real estate. Nevertheless, there are still some first-time home buyers today that choose to instantly purchase their dream homes. Most buyers mainly consider the price of a property but they are also concerned about how much more convenient it would be for them to move after the purchase. A very excellent move-in condition and the thought of finally staying in a house that they have been dreaming about make these kinds of buyers willing to stretch their budget. They are also the ones that can be considered as the most emotionally-driven and tend to pay higher than what they initially intended.
Meanwhile, some factors have drastically changed over the years and these are some of the reasons why most home buyers get discouraged from buying Nokomis homes for sale on their first purchase. The higher prices of commodities these days can still affect a buyer’s budget allocated for housing payments despite having an annual salary increase.
Unlike before, there are more couples who decide to become both wage earners. Couples who are both working mostly rely on their combined incomes. This only means that financial problems occur if ever one of them stops working. In addition, though it is much easier to qualify for a mortgage now, people tend to believe that because of this, they could actually spend more than what is financially manageable.
Some people who buy homes for the first time focus only on the aspect of finally owning a house. Thus, they are willing to buy those regular homes and even purchase older houses in order to save more money and avoid going beyond the limits of their budget. There are home buyers who try to be patient enough to build equity through time. Apparently, they would purchase simple homes at first but they are also willing to wait and are preparing themselves for opportunities that might enable them to eventually buy their dream homes in the future.
